I want to write a fairly trivial database driven application, it will
basically present a few columns from a database, allow the user to add
and/or edit rows, recalculate the values in one column and write the
data back to the database.

I want to show the data and allow editing of the data in a datagrid as
being able to see adjacent/previous data will help a huge amount when
entering data.

So what toolkits are there out there for doing this sort of thing?  A
GUI toolkit would be lovely (allowing layout etc.) but isn't
absolutely necessary.

I'm a reasonably experienced programmer and know python quite well
but I'm fairly much a beginner with event driven GUI stuff so I need
a user friendly framework.
